在CentOS系统上使用pgAdmin进行PostgreSQL数据库的恢复数据方法主要有以下几种:
使用pg_restore命令:例如,要恢复名为mydatabase的数据库,使用以下命令:
pg_restore -U postgres -d mydatabase /path/to/backupfile.sql
```。
在执行此操作时,系统会提示您输入密码,输入相应的密码并按Enter键。等待命令执行完成,完成后,您将在指定的目录中找到导出的SQL文件,数据库恢复完成。
使用pg_basebackup命令进行物理备份恢复:例如:
pg_basebackup -h localhost -U postgres -D /path/to/restore -P -X stream -R
```。
pg_rman init -B /home/postgres/backup
pg_rman backup --backup-mode full -B /home/postgres/backup
pg_rman backup --backup-mode incremental -B /home/postgres/backup
pg_rman recover /home/postgres/backup
pg_rman recover /home/postgres/backup
。在执行恢复操作之前,请确保备份文件的完整性和适用性,并在非生产环境中先行测试恢复流程,以避免数据丢失或系统中断。定期验证备份文件的完整性,以确保在需要时能够成功恢复。